How Can You Keep Your Makeup Smudge Free?

Date:

Keeping your makeup from smudging is hard, especially when it’s hot outside. But there are things you can do to keep smudges and smears from happening. It’s great to be able to put on your makeup and then go about your day. You don’t need to worry about your makeup staying on when life is already stressful.

1. Pick a Primer You Like

A primer is meant to help your makeup go on better and remain in place. But not all primers are the same. You might have to try a few different primers before you find one you really like. You may find primers from many different brands and at many different prices. You might want to start with a brand that has worked for you in the past. Another excellent thing about primer is that you don’t need a lot of it.

2. Use Blotting Cloths

Have you ever been in this situation? When you glance in the mirror, you see that your face is oily and your makeup is smudged all over. You might want to grab your powder right away, but there is a better way to fix the problem because powder can make your face look dry and cakey. In this case, blotting cloths are the finest choice. They get rid of the oil, sweat, and dirt without making the smearing problem worse like powder does.

3. Choose Waterproof Mascara and Eyeliner

For me, eye makeup is the most likely to smear. It’s very annoying! Who wants to spend all day looking for mirrors to make sure their eye makeup isn’t smudging their face? Not this girl! Using waterproof mascara and eyeliner is the finest thing I’ve found to do.

4. When you cry, dab instead of rubbing.

I cry a lot. I cry at weddings, sappy films, emotional times, and when my hormones are acting up. This little trick is for people like me who cry a lot. Instead of rubbing your eyes when you cry, dab them. Rubbing makes your makeup look much worse.

5. Blot Your Lipstick

Does your lipstick often get smudged? You might have noticed that it bleeds out of your natural lip line as the day goes on. You can stop that from happening by blotting it. You don’t have to wipe it all off; just a small blot can eliminate smearing. Lip liner is also good for keeping it in place.

6. Change Your Foundation

You might be wearing the wrong kind of foundation if you feel like your whole face gets smudged and smeared as the day goes on, not just a few problem areas. Try using a matte formula instead. You could also pick a foundation that says things like “shine control” on it. You should definitely steer clear from foundations that add extra moisture. If your makeup is always smearing, you need a foundation that doesn’t have as much moisture.

7. Put in a product that makes things less shiny.

You might need to go a step further if changing your foundation doesn’t give you the outcomes you want. You might need to use a cream that is made just for making your skin look less shiny.
